Use "scorpion" in a sentence | "scorpion" example sentences

How to use "scorpion" in a sentence?

  • My mother only said: Thank God the scorpion picked on me and spared my children.
    -Nissim Ezekiel-
  • Old Japanese saying, live scorpion in pants makes life interesting.
    -Will Hobbs-
  • I think making a pretense of civility toward Eric Alterman is like making a pretense of civility to a scorpion.
    -John Podhoretz-
  • Envy, if surrounded on all sides by the brightness of another's prosperity, like the scorpion confined within a circle of fire, will sting itself to death.
    -Charles Caleb Colton-
  • I will now make a scorpion appear in Osama bin Laden's pants
    -David Copperfield-
  • The Scorpion connects with the Serpent through the Dragon.
    -Dion Fortune-
  • That's the problem with them fables, they're putting animals together that wouldn't meet. I don't know where a scorpion is knockin' around with a frog.
    -Karl Pilkington-
  • A male scorpion is stabbed to death after mating. In chess, the powerful queen often does the same to the king without giving him the satisfaction of a lover.
    -Gregor Piatigorsky-
